Privacy Trees Planting in Honolulu, HI
Privacy Trees Planting services involve selecting and planting trees that enhance privacy and create natural screening on residential properties. This service covers a variety of projects, including planting new trees to block views, establishing windbreaks, or creating secluded outdoor spaces. Property owners typically want to understand the types of trees suitable for their specific location, the spacing needed for effective privacy, and how to ensure the trees thrive over time. Considerations such as soil conditions, sun exposure, and future growth are important factors to discuss before proceeding with planting plans.
Homeowners often request privacy tree planting to improve outdoor comfort, reduce noise, or add aesthetic value to their property. It’s useful to know the desired level of screening, the size and maturity of trees at planting, and any nearby structures or utilities that might influence planting choices. Planning for ongoing maintenance and understanding the growth patterns of selected trees can also help ensure the privacy landscape develops as intended.

Privacy Trees Planting Questions
What are Privacy Trees? Privacy trees are strategically planted to create natural screens that block views and add privacy to outdoor spaces.
Which types of trees are suitable for privacy purposes? Fast-growing, dense species like ficus, arborvitae, and certain evergreen varieties are commonly used for privacy.
How should privacy trees be maintained? Regular watering, mulching, and pruning help keep privacy trees healthy and effective as screening plants.
